How Double Glazing Helps with Better Efficiency
Space between the panes in double glazing limits heat transfer. This choice helps if you're looking to cut carbon use.

Energy Saving Without Ruining the Original Style
Timber sash windows in traditional buildings are recognised for letting heat slip away. Slimline double glazing cut heat loss and still suit the original sash frame.
